| The laptop performs well for everyday tasks but may struggle with resource-heavy programs. Gaming is limited due to the lack of discrete graphics. The 256GB SSD is sufficient for storing files. More RAM would improve performance. The 2 USB ports are adequate. The Full HD display offers clear picture quality for movies and YouTube. | ||
